Has anyone run into this? My 97 Exploer (SOHC) started leaking steering fluid. My mechanic said I needed to replace 2 hoses. The main hose is Ford part number 3A719 and cost approx $150. I purchased this item from the dealership and my mechanic says there is no way this hose will actually fit in the vehicle. I've looked at the diagram provided to me by the dealership and it looks like my mechanic is correct. The hose, in reality, is angled in the opposite direction to how it appears in the diagram. Despite the diagram, the dealership insists that this is the correct part. Any help is greatly appreciated.
